Conquering the Trails with Unrivaled Suspension

One of the most talked-about features of the 2015 Arctic Cat Wildcat 1000, and indeed the entire Wildcat line, is its incredible suspension system. Arctic Cat didn't just slap some shocks on this thing; they engineered a true off-road marvel. We're talking about a massive 13 inches of front suspension travel and a jaw-dropping 13.2 inches of rear suspension travel. Guys, that's serious travel! What does that mean for you out on the trail? It means the Wildcat 1000 can soak up the bumps, rocks, and ruts like a champ. You’ll experience a ride that's smoother and more controlled, even when the terrain gets seriously gnarly. The double A-arm front suspension and the 5-link solid rear axle work in harmony to keep all four tires firmly planted, providing exceptional traction and stability. This suspension isn't just about comfort, though; it's about performance. It allows you to maintain higher speeds over rough ground, maintain control when you need it most, and ultimately, have more fun. Imagine flying over whoops and moguls with confidence, feeling connected to the trail but buffered from the harshest impacts. That’s the magic of the Wildcat's suspension. It’s designed to mimic the articulation of a rock crawler while offering the speed and agility of a sport ATV. Plus, the adjustable FOX shocks allow you to fine-tune the ride to your liking and the specific conditions you're facing. Whether you prefer a softer, more forgiving ride or a stiffer, more performance-oriented setup, you can dial it in. This level of adjustability is crucial for any serious off-roader who wants to maximize their machine's potential. It’s this attention to detail in the suspension that truly sets the 2015 Wildcat 1000 apart from its competitors and cements its reputation as a top-tier off-road vehicle.

Powering Through Anything: The Wildcat's Engine and Drivetrain

Let’s get down to the heart of the matter: the power plant. The 2015 Arctic Cat Wildcat 1000 is propelled by a potent 1000cc V-twin, liquid-cooled, SOHC engine. This isn't some small-displacement engine; this is a serious mill designed to deliver serious torque and horsepower when you need it most. We're talking about 80-plus horsepower ready to be unleashed. This raw power translates directly to the trail, allowing you to climb steep inclines, blast through mud, and accelerate out of corners with authority. The engine's V-twin configuration is known for its broad powerband and satisfying torque, making it ideal for the demanding nature of off-road riding. Whether you're crawling over rocks or ripping across open fields, the Wildcat 1000 has the grunt to get you there. Mated to this powerful engine is Arctic Cat's Rapid Engagement (RE) CVT transmission. This isn't just any CVT; it's designed for quick and responsive engagement, meaning less lag and more immediate power delivery when you hit the throttle. This is crucial in off-road situations where split-second power can mean the difference between making it over an obstacle or getting stuck. The drivetrain also features selectable 2WD/4WD with front differential lock. This versatility is a game-changer. Need maximum traction for climbing or navigating slick terrain? Flip it into 4WD with the diff lock engaged. Want a more playful, agile ride on less demanding trails? Switch to 2WD. The ability to easily switch between these modes on the fly gives you the confidence and control to tackle virtually any situation. Furthermore, the on-demand 4WD system automatically engages the front wheels when slippage is detected, ensuring you always have power where you need it. This sophisticated drivetrain system, combined with the robust engine, ensures that the 2015 Arctic Cat Wildcat 1000 is not just powerful but also intelligent and adaptable, ready to tackle whatever the wilderness throws its way. It's this blend of brute force and smart engineering that makes the Wildcat 1000 a true force to be reckoned with in the SxS world, offering an exhilarating and capable off-road experience for riders of all skill levels.
